What is ABA Therapy?

ABA therapy is a proven, data-driven method used to help individuals develop and refine essential skills across multiple domains. It focuses on identifying specific behaviors that need to be changed or improved and uses positive reinforcement strategies to promote meaningful, measurable progress. ABA therapy is based on a deep understanding of behavior, and we use it to not only reduce challenging behaviors but to also enhance social, communication, academic and self-help skills. ABA techniques breaks down goals into small, manageable steps to help children gradually achieve larger goals without making the learning process too difficult for the child.

Will ABA make my child robotic?

Robotic behavior is a common misconception about ABA therapy. However, this misconception is based on outdated methods or poorly implemented ABA programs. Modern ABA programs, as followed in The Speech Clinic, Dubai, are designed to be adaptable, flexible and individualized to the learner.

?
What role does reinforcement play in ABA therapy?

Reinforcement is used to encourage desirable behaviors. Positive behaviors are rewarded, which increases the likelihood of those behaviors being repeated in the future.

?
How are progress and goals measured in ABA therapy?

Progress is tracked using data and assessments. Goals are broken down into measurable steps, and ongoing evaluation ensures that the therapy is effective in meeting those goals.

What does a typical ABA session look like?

A typical ABA session includes one-on-one therapy where the therapist uses positive reinforcement to work on specific skills. Teaching skills can be done through naturalistic environment training, tabletop activities or through a play-based approach, but sessions involve structured activities, depending on what is best suited for the child. Progress is tracked to ensure goals are being achieved.

How can ABA help with harmful or destructive behaviors?

ABA therapy helps identify the triggers of harmful behaviors and replaces them with positive alternatives. Behavior management strategies are used to reduce such behaviors and teach more functional ways of responding to challenges.
